What I Considered About Safety
My next concern was safety. I looked at whether the product is generally recognized for its intended purpose and whether there were any warnings for people with specific health conditions. I always think it is important to be cautious with probiotics if someone is immunocompromised, pregnant, or dealing with a serious illness. For me, any buying decision should include reading the label carefully and asking a healthcare professional when needed.
How I Checked the Seller
I also paid attention to where the product was being sold. I prefer buying from trusted retailers or the official brand source because that lowers the chance of counterfeit or expired products. If a seller had vague descriptions, unusually low prices, or poor return policies, I treated that as a warning sign. In my experience, the seller matters almost as much as the product.
